Indications for: EUFLEXXA
Osteoarthritis of the knee in patients who have failed nonpharmacologic therapy and analgesics (eg, acetaminophen).
Adult Dosage:
Prior to treatment: remove joint effusion (use separate syringe), if present. Inject 2mL (full syringe contents) intra-articularly in each affected knee weekly for 3 weeks. Use separate syringes for each knee.
Children Dosage:
Not recommended.
EUFLEXXA Contraindications:
Knee joint infection or skin disease at inj site.
EUFLEXXA Warnings/Precautions:
Repeated treatment cycles: not established. Avoid intravascular injection. Avoid strenuous activity within 48hrs after injection. Pregnancy. Nursing mothers.
EUFLEXXA Classification:
Hyaluronan.
EUFLEXXA Interactions:
Avoid disinfectants with quaternary ammonium salts. Concomitant other intra-articular injectables: not recommended.
Adverse Reactions:
Arthralgia, increase blood pressure, inj site pain, local reactions, transient knee inflammation.
How Supplied:
Single-use prefilled syringes (2mL)—1
